Birmingham, AL – Trick-or-treaters in central Alabama can expect a picture-perfect Halloween evening this year, with clear skies, calm winds, and cool fall temperatures, according to the National Weather Service in Birmingham.

After a stretch of gloomy weather, conditions are expected to improve just in time for Thursday night’s festivities. Forecasters say skies will remain clear with no rain or strong winds, creating ideal weather for outdoor Halloween events.

Temperatures are forecast to hover around 58°F at 5 p.m., dropping to 51°F by 7 p.m., and dipping into the upper 40s by 9 p.m. The NWS noted that a 70% illuminated moon will add to the spooky atmosphere, while a light, chilly breeze settles over the region.

No rain is expected, and travel conditions across central Alabama should remain favorable throughout the evening. Residents are encouraged to dress warmly and enjoy a calm, cool Halloween night under clear skies.
